So here's how the boss works:
First, you load it up with Shock attacks to fill its break gauge. Once it's broken, you charge up a shock orb and fire it at the boss. It's vulnerable now, tear into it. Second phase, break it again as usual, but now instead of firing the shock orb at the boss, you fire it at the wall, and use the button and orb launcher. Then for the third phase, you repeat what you did for the second phase, but after the first orb launcher fires it, slide to the button below/above you real fast to launch the orb again. The fourth phase, you don't have to break it, it's just a slugfest now.

Yeah, slime is an awful boss IMO, and a lot of it is because of his tiny, misleading arena. He floats in the center whenever he's not attacking which makes you think you're supposed to use the shock orb things, but actually you're supposed to break him with regular shock attacks first which sends him into a different set of attacks that are...kind of easier to dodge, but he only does 3 of them before his break resets. It really doesn't help that the only real way to stand on a button in time is to fire your charge shot from next to the button, but that opens you up to accidentally shooting the ball the wrong way around the arena because you angled your shot too far in one direction or the other, because you're shooting into a right angle from almost directly above it. Which of course wastes the ball and forces you to start the phase over.

Tesla boy is much better. The arena is much bigger, the boss's attacks are much less likely to hit you, his weakness is the HP/regen element instead of a glass cannon element, and the timing on his phases is much more generous. The only advantage slime has is that you don't need to break him in phase 3.

So'najiz boss was much easier than the Zir'vitar boss for me, personally. I think your biggest issue was charging up the lightning ball.

...Just melee it at a wall, then run to the switch you need based on which direction it flies. If you have any Assault at all, it charges up and fires in 2 hits. No need to do any careful aiming.

The boss is also very telegraphed and repeats the same attacks in a set sequence which you can literally dodge by moving/dodging around the block in circles. To break the boss, just charge your SP and use the LightningThrow2 Art (Radiant Swarm) as he's charging up his ranged attack. It's an instant break.

Run around until he moves towards you and just dodge perpendicularly to him before he hits you... Really, it's clearly not impossible to dodge because tons of people have gotten past that point. I could probably do that fight with glass cannon equips. If you're really having trouble, optimize into survivability with your equips...

If you wanna break the game, just maximize defense on your equips and Circuit, use the Cold element, and use HP Regen buff items. You should be taking very little damage from the boss.

Alternatively, do the Zir'vitar Temple first and pick up the Wave element if you're really finding it impossible. All the challenge goes away, as you'll have high resists...
